aboutsummaryrefslogtreecommitdiffstats
path: root/examples
diff options
context:
space:
mode:
authors-ol <s+removethis@s-ol.nu>2025-09-03 21:32:10 +0000
committers-ol <s+removethis@s-ol.nu>2025-09-14 15:39:20 +0000
commit76fcdb02fc595d4381e4f1d13f816c1fbee235e1 (patch)
treefd12e68968f351056b6966b308135df61b8ee5d8 /examples
parentrefactor Tag/Registry, reuse deleted tags (diff)
downloadalive-76fcdb02fc595d4381e4f1d13f816c1fbee235e1.tar.gz
alive-76fcdb02fc595d4381e4f1d13f816c1fbee235e1.zip
lib/glsl-view: use tag for texture, uniform names
Diffstat (limited to 'examples')
-rw-r--r--examples/glsl-view/simple.alv6
-rw-r--r--examples/glsl-view/stream-controls.alv18
-rw-r--r--examples/glsl-view/stream.alv10
3 files changed, 17 insertions, 17 deletions
diff --git a/examples/glsl-view/simple.alv b/examples/glsl-view/simple.alv
index 64e3335..02c8796 100644
--- a/examples/glsl-view/simple.alv
+++ b/examples/glsl-view/simple.alv
@@ -1,12 +1,12 @@
([1]import* glsl-view time math)
([2]import osc)
-([3]def *oscout* ([4]osc/connect 'localhost' 9000))
+([4]def *oscout* ([3]osc/connect 'localhost' 9000))
-([5]draw $[6]shader"
+([7]draw $[6]shader"
in vec2 uv;
out vec4 color;
void main() {
- color = vec4(uv, sin(uv.x + $([7]ramp 1 tau)), 1);
+ color = vec4(uv, sin(uv.x + $([5]ramp 1 tau)), 1);
}")
diff --git a/examples/glsl-view/stream-controls.alv b/examples/glsl-view/stream-controls.alv
index 5fd5a03..936dac9 100644
--- a/examples/glsl-view/stream-controls.alv
+++ b/examples/glsl-view/stream-controls.alv
@@ -1,17 +1,17 @@
([1]import* glsl-view link-time)
([2]import osc)
-([3]def
- *clock* ([4]clock false 120)
- *oscout* ([5]osc/connect 'localhost' 9000))
+([5]def
+ *clock* ([3]clock false 120)
+ *oscout* ([4]osc/connect 'localhost' 9000))
-([6]def
- paused? ([7]switch ([8]every 2) true false)
- cam ([9]doto ([10]stream-source 'webcam' '2D' '/dev/video0')
- ([11]freeze paused?)
- ([12]step! ([13]every 0.5))))
+([13]def
+ paused? ([7]switch ([6]every 2) true false)
+ cam ([12]doto ([8]stream-source '2D' '/dev/video0')
+ ([9]freeze paused?)
+ ([11]step! ([10]every 0.5))))
-([14]draw $[15]shader"
+([15]draw $[14]shader"
in vec2 uv;
out vec4 color;
diff --git a/examples/glsl-view/stream.alv b/examples/glsl-view/stream.alv
index 1ca2c63..4f40645 100644
--- a/examples/glsl-view/stream.alv
+++ b/examples/glsl-view/stream.alv
@@ -1,12 +1,12 @@
([1]import* glsl-view time)
([2]import osc)
-([3]def *oscout* ([5]osc/connect 'localhost' 9000))
+([4]def *oscout* ([3]osc/connect 'localhost' 9000))
-([6]def cam ([7]stream-source 'webcam' '2D' '/dev/video0')
- tst ([8]stream-source 'testpt' '2D' 'testsrc=size=1280x720:rate=30' 'lavfi'))
+([7]def cam ([5]stream-source '2D' '/dev/video0')
+ tst ([6]stream-source '2D' 'testsrc=size=1280x720:rate=30' 'lavfi'))
-([9]draw $[10]shader"
+([10]draw $[9]shader"
in vec2 uv;
out vec4 color;
@@ -14,7 +14,7 @@ void main() {
vec3 cam = texture($cam , uv).rgb;
vec3 tst = texture($tst , uv).rgb;
- color.rgb = mix(cam, tst, $([11]lfo 1));
+ color.rgb = mix(cam, tst, $([8]lfo 1));
color.a = 1.0;
}")